Pipe Repairs is a core plumbing service centered on fixing the integrity of damaged or deteriorating pipes within residential and commercial systems. Whether addressing corrosion, cracks, joint failures, or burst pipes, the service includes precise evaluation and reliable solutions, such as epoxy lining, clamping, or pipe section replacement. The goal is sustained performance and prevention of future disruptions
